Clinical SAS Programmer: In charge of developing analysis datasets, programming clinical trial data, and producing reports for regulatory submissions.
Biostatistician: A biostatistician examines data from clinical trials and offers statistical analysis for medication development and approval processes.
Clinical Data Analyst: Overseeing and evaluating data from clinical trials to guarantee precision, adherence, and useful insights.
Clinical Data Manager: Supervising the process of gathering and validating data for clinical studies to guarantee the integrity and quality of the data.
Regulatory Affairs Specialist: Producing data reports using SAS for regulatory filings with organizations such as Health Canada or the FDA.
Healthcare Data Scientist: Using SAS expertise to evaluate huge healthcare datasets and offer suggestions for enhancing patient outcomes is what healthcare data scientists do.
These positions, which offer excellent pay and opportunities for advancement in the healthcare sector, are highly sought after in the pharmaceutical, biotechnology, and contract research organizations (CROs) in the USA and Canada.

SDTM (Study Data Tabulation Model) and Adam (Analysis Data Model) are standardized formats for clinical trial data used in regulatory submissions.
